A minimum of 8 units ofscreening coursesmust have been completed at UC San Diegoprior to application: CSE 8B or 11, CSE 12, CSE 15L, CSE 20 (MATH 15A or MATH 109 may be substituted for CSE 20 if taken first), CSE 21 (or MATH 154 or MATH 184), CSE 30, and CSE 100. All of the following screening courses that have been taken at UCSD (or their approved petitioned equivalent taken at UCSD) will be used to calculate the GPA for the change of major application: CSE 8B or 11, CSE 12, CSE 15L, CSE 20 (or MATH 15A or MATH 109), CSE 21, CSE 30, and CSE 100. Because of the large number of students interested in data science and the limited resources available to accommodate this demand, the university has declared the data science major capped. This allows the Data Science Undergraduate Program to continue to offer the highest quality academic program to our students and avoid delays in time to degree due to lack of capacity in our courses. Students must apply by the end of their sixth academic quarter at UC San Diego.
